Hlavním problémem s možností zrušení výběru je to, že může způsobit problémy při pokusu o použití jQuery k výběru prvků. Máte-li k výběru mnoho prvků, může použití možnosti zrušit výběr způsobit, že se výběr stane neplatným.
$("#myselect option").prop("selected", false);
Tento řádek kódu používá jQuery k výběru prvku s id „myselect“ a poté všech jeho podřízených prvků volby. Pro každý z těchto prvků možnosti kód nastaví vlastnost „selected“ na hodnotu false.
Formuláře
V jQuery můžete použít několik různých typů formulářů.
Nejjednodušším typem formuláře je textové pole. Chcete-li vytvořit textové pole, jednoduše přidejte do dokumentu následující kód:
Poté můžete pomocí metody getText() získat hodnotu textového pole.
Formulář textové oblasti můžete také vytvořit přidáním následujícího kódu do dokumentu:
Poté použijte metody getText() a setText() k ovládání obsahu textové oblasti.
Práce s formuláři
Existuje několik způsobů, jak pracovat s formuláři v jQuery. Jedním ze způsobů je použití funkce $.getJSON() k získání dat z formuláře. Data pak můžete použít k naplnění prvků na stránce.
Dalším způsobem je použít funkci $.ajax() k odeslání dat z formuláře na server. Server pak může data zpracovat a vrátit je zpět na stránku.
Tipy pro formuláře v jQuery
UI
Existuje několik tipů pro práci s formuláři v uživatelském rozhraní jQuery. Nejprve můžete použít prvky formuláře jako prvky DOM. To znamená, že s nimi můžete manipulovat stejně jako s jakýmkoli jiným prvkem v dokumentu. Za druhé, data formuláře můžete použít k naplnění dalších prvků na stránce. Nakonec můžete použít událost odeslání formuláře ke sledování vstupu uživatelů a odpovídajícím způsobem reagovat.